[vc_row][vc_column][vc_column_text]DEERFIELD BEACH GRILLED CHEESE SANDWICH IS A WINNER:  A soon to open Deerfield Beach Restaurant is listed among the “craziest” grilled cheese sandwiches in South Florida based on a review in the Sun-Sentinel.

I Heart Mac and Cheese is a relatively new and rapidly growing restaurant chain with locations projected to open in four states.  The company is based in Boca Raton and currently has four restaurants in Broward County (Fort Lauderdale, Davie, Pembroke Pines and Coral Springs).  A Cooper City location is scheduled to open next month and the Deerfield Beach restaurant is projected to open in September. The Deerfield Beach location is located in the Shoppes at Deerfield, off West Hillsboro Boulevard and Powerline Road.

The Sun-Sentinel’s Catie Wegman says, the I Heart Mac and Cheese “grilled cheese ($8.95) allows guests to add one cheese, one protein and unlimited veggies to the sandwich and top it all off with mac and cheese for $3 more. The Best of Both Worlds ($11.95) is also a baked mac and cheese sandwich with short rib, white cheddar and American cheese and BBQ sauce.”  Catie also reviews three other Broward restaurants known for their grilled cheese sandwiches as well as several others in South Florida.  You can read her full review here.

Take a look at the I Heart Mac and Cheese menu.  The grilled cheese sandwich isn’t even their specialty.  They offer all sorts of  interesting pasta combinations at moderate prices. This will definitely be a tasty addition to the mix of restaurants in Deerfield Beach when it opens in September.
